How it works

The restoration process

1

Initial assessment

A technician inspects the affected areas of your Camden-Wyoming property and identifies the source and extent of the water intrusion.

2

Mitigation plan

Based on the assessment, a mitigation plan is put together - what needs extracting, drying, or removing, and roughly how long it will take.

3

Water extraction

Standing water is removed using pumps and extraction equipment, prioritizing areas at the highest risk of further damage.

4

Structural drying

Air movers and dehumidifiers are set up to dry out affected materials, with moisture levels checked periodically over the following days.

5

Sanitization

Affected surfaces are cleaned and treated to address contamination risk and reduce the chance of mold developing afterward.

6

Final inspection

A final check confirms materials are back within a safe moisture range, and documentation is provided for insurance purposes.

FAQ

Common questions in Camden-Wyoming

What equipment is used for water extraction?

Technicians typically use industrial wet vacuums for extraction, followed by air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the affected area over several days.

Do flood cleanup crews handle mud and debris removal?

Yes, mud, silt, and debris removal is typically part of the flood cleanup process before drying equipment is set up.

Will emergency mitigation work be covered before my claim is approved?

Many policies cover emergency mitigation (like water extraction) to prevent further damage even before a full claim is approved, though this depends on your specific policy.

What's removed after a sewage backup - just the water, or more?

Beyond water extraction, porous materials like carpet, some drywall, and insulation exposed to sewage often need to be removed and disposed of due to contamination.

Can a restoration provider help with my insurance claim directly?

Many independent providers document damage with photos and moisture readings and can coordinate directly with your insurance adjuster, though the claim decision itself is between you and your insurer.

How do you know when an area is fully dry?

Moisture meters and hygrometers are used to measure moisture levels in materials like drywall and flooring, confirming they've returned to a safe range before drying equipment is removed.

Can flooded electrical outlets and wiring be safely cleaned?

Power should be shut off before any cleanup near flooded electrical systems, and an electrician may need to inspect wiring before it's reconnected.
